Default X-CAL 2 question

Ok, so I went in to get my oil changed at the dealership so I set my tune back to stock. When I get my car back I pull over and set it back to my 93 octane tune. But, when I get on it I notice I hit the rev limiter way too early. Ok... so I bump it up to 6500 and I still keep hitting it before I should. Like at the stock 6250 or whatever it is. I even bumped both limiters, drive and neutral to 6500 and it is still hitting it wayyyy toooo early.

The car runs great but I don't understand what is going on...

Any advice would be much appreciated!!
